John Locke argued that people have natural rights to

A.life, liberty, and property
B.life, liberty, and happiness only
C.obey any ruler without question
D.property only for nobles

Explanation

Core Concept

Locke held that these rights precede government, which exists to protect them.

Correct Answer

Alife, liberty, and property
